Third Definition & Meaning

third
adverb
  1. in the third place; "third we must consider unemployment"
adjective
  1. coming next after the second and just before the fourth in position
noun
  1. one of three equal parts of a divisible whole; "it contains approximately a third of the minimum daily requirement"
  2. the fielding position of the player on a baseball team who is stationed near the third of the bases in the infield (counting counterclockwise from home plate); "he is playing third"
  3. following the second position in an ordering or series; "a distant third"; "he answered the first question willingly, the second reluctantly, and the third with resentment"
  4. the musical interval between one note and another three notes away from it; "a simple harmony written in major thirds"
  5. the third from the lowest forward ratio gear in the gear box of a motor vehicle; "you shouldn't try to start in third gear"
  6. the base that must be touched third by a base runner in baseball; "he was cut down on a close play at third"
